Windows Terminal version (or Windows build number)

1.12.2931.0

Other Software

No response

Steps to reproduce

  1. Open Windows Terminal with a starting-directory and command-line set, for example:

    %localappdata%\Microsoft\WindowsApps\wt.exe new-tab --commandline %SystemRoot%\System32\cmd.exe /c "path/to/python-environment.bat && python.exe path/to/interactive/program.py"
    
  2. Press the keyboard shortcut to duplicate the current tab: ctrl+shift+d

    • Alternatively, split the pane.
  3. Observe that the duplicated tab does not invoke the command-line given in --commandline

    • Starting directory (-d) is also not applied.

Expected Behavior

I expect that the duplicate tab (or pane) should be a true duplicate. I.e. it should be created with precisely the initialization parameters of the original tab (or pane), including at least the following most important ones:

  • Profile
  • Starting Directory
  • Command Line

Actual Behavior

  • The duplicated tab does not invoke the command-line given in --commandline
  • Starting directory (-d) is also not applied.
